OFF-SITE RUN CHECKLIST — Item 4: Exhibition Loans

Receiving site (Calloway Gallery Annex): verify that all six loaned pieces from the Renshaw Collection arrive crated, with intact tamper seals and condition reports enclosed. Check crate numbers against the loan manifest before signing; photograph any damage immediately and quarantine the crate. Do not unpack without the registrar present. The confidential courier hand-over instruction follows this item.

courier memo of tawep-tajep: the quenius ulaiel courier leaves the fenir ledger at gate 9128 under passcode 527513

Q: The roof-terrace door at Sablewick Court keeps jamming — what should I do? A: This is a known fault with the weather seal, logged with Facilities at Drossmere Group. Do not force the handle downward, as this can trigger the alarm contact. Instead, lift the handle slightly, push at hip height, and the latch should release. If you're escorting guests to the terrace for an event, allow extra time. The current terrace access code is listed below.

staff pass of kawip-hawef = bdg-QLP-2

**Mgmt Meeting Minutes — Retiring the Brightline Range**

Quick recap for sales leads at Fenholt Supplies: we agreed to retire the Brightline fixture range by year-end. Remaining stock moves to clearance pricing next month, and accounts on standing orders get migrated to the Lumetta range. Trade-in incentives were approved in principle. The confidential note on next steps sits just below.

board note of bajof-bajeg: The pricing group signed off on a budget of $13.4 million for Project Sildor. The renewal with Lamixek Holdings closes at $48.9 million a year, 49 percent above the last contract.

## RateSentry: restart after scrape stall

If parity checks stop updating, first confirm the Fetchwell queue is draining. If not, restart the scraper pod and flush the stale comparison cache. The service will refuse to rehydrate without a valid credential for the internal TariffCore API, so have it ready before restarting. Do not reuse keys from the demo environment; they are scoped to sandbox hotels only and will silently return empty rate sets. The production TariffCore key is pasted below.

service key, fawip-bajef: kto11_Qt5wZK9vdNC